Only 15 years ago there were no solutions outside of using glued sheet vinyl for glue down hardwood applications, or the older horrible gooey mastic approach with sleeper system. Sleeper On Slab System The sleeper system that entailed fastening 2' X 4's to the concrete laid on their side has faded from use. The slab must be a minimum of 3,000 psi; lightweight concrete is not acceptable unless you are installing a floating floor or a wood subfloor over the slab.
